Crisis help

The CRC does not provide crisis services. If you are experiencing a crisis, please use the following resources.

For emergencies during regular business hours, we recommend that you contact the Center for Counseling and Student Development at 302-831-2141. However, if you prefer, you may instead call UD Helpline, 24/7/365 at 302-831-1001, during business hours and in the evening.

  • In the event you are calling to connect with an S.O.S. Victim Advocate related to sexual misconduct, press prompt 1.
  • If you are calling to connect with a counselor, press prompt 2.

In case of dire emergency involving the safety of someone, University Police should be contacted.

If calling from on-campus, dial: 911
If calling from off-campus, dial: 302-831-2222

The Center for Counseling and Student Development may then be asked to provide assistance once immediate safety is secured.
